Welcome to our team in eastern/northern Lapland student welfare! We are looking for a psychologist for student welfare in a permanent position starting on August 3, 2026, or by agreement. The workplace is located in Kolarri in the northern region. Psychologists working in student welfare are part of multidisciplinary student welfare teams at their respective educational institutions. In your work, you will provide psychological expertise for preschools and educational institutions and work to promote the well-being, safety, and positive learning environment of students and the school community. The scope of work extends from early childhood and basic education to secondary education. In Lapland, the goal of a student welfare psychologist's work is not only to cope under pressure but also to develop credible means to promote learning and well-being and to prevent problems, as well as to implement these in everyday life. Your role as a student welfare psychologist includes: - Bringing psychological expertise to the community work of educational institutions and assessing and developing the functionality of community work. - Consulting, advising, and guiding children and young people on development, mental health, and well-being issues within schools and educational institutions. - Assessing, advising, and guiding students' mental well-being. - Evaluating issues related to the development, school attendance, and learning of children and young people, and planning and implementing support measures in collaboration with students, guardians, and educational staff. - Planning, implementing, and preparing recommendations and statements on psychological methods and assessment data. Työmarkkinatori is Finland's official public employment service portal, operated by the Ministry of Economic Affairs and Employment (TEM). It lists job openings from across the Finnish public sector, municipalities, and employers who use the government's recruitment infrastructure.
